The British send 11 million text messages per hour

February 8th, 2010 by Matthew Obrien Leave a reply »

According to the Mobile Data Association (MDA), in 2009, 96.8 billion text messages were sent – that’s 11 million text messages per hour or 265 million per day. Recent research by Tekelec found that 60% of people over the age of 45 are now just as likely to use text messaging as they are to make a voice call.

It also revealed that 44% of 35 to 44-year-olds and 14% of over-45s send more than 30 text messages every week. more
